#45906B Hex Color Code

#45906B

The Hexadecimal Color #45906B is a contrast shade of Sea Green. #45906B RGB value is rgb(69, 144, 107). RGB Color Model of #45906B consists of 27% red, 56% green and 41% blue. HSL color Mode of #45906B has 150°(degrees) Hue, 35% Saturation and 42% Lightness. #45906B color has an wavelength of 525.55556n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#45906B is #669999.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#45906B is #486. The Closest Color to #45906B is #2E8B57. Official Name of #45906B Hex Code is Viridian.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#45906B is 52 Cyan 0 Magenta 26 Yellow 44 Black and #45906B CMY is 52, 0, 26.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#45906B is hsl(150,35,42,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(150, 52, 56).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#45906B is 15.08, 22.27, 17.41.
Hex8 Value of #45906B is #45906BFF. Decimal Value of #45906B is 4558955 and Octal Value of #45906B is 21310153. Binary Value of #45906B is 1000101, 10010000, 1101011 and Android of #45906B is 4282749035 / 0xff45906b.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#45906B is 0.275, 0.407, 0.407 and YIQ Color Space of #45906B is 117.357, -32.8044, -27.3769.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#45906B is 17.79, 27.3, 17.47.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#45906B is 54.31, -32.39, 12.67.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#45906B is 54.31, -33.57, 21.91.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#45906B is 54.31, 34.78, 158.64. Hunter Lab variable of #45906B is 47.19, -25.54, 11.16.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#45906B

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
